How much does it cost to rent an apartment in Old Orchard Beach?
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
---|---|---|---|
Cheap Old Orchard Beach Studio Apartments | $1,750 | $1,700 | $1,800 |
Cheap Old Orchard Beach 1 Bedroom Apartments | $2,362 | $2,150 | $2,500 |
Cheap Old Orchard Beach 2 Bedroom Apartments | $2,433 | $1,700 | $3,000 |
Cheap Old Orchard Beach 3 Bedroom Apartments | $2,466 | $2,400 | $2,500 |

Best Value Apartments for Rent in Old Orchard Beach, ME
As of April 24, 2025 the best value apartment in the Old Orchard Beach area is the $2.08 price per square foot 104 Ocean Ave Model at 104 Ocean Ave, Unit D in the starting from $2,500. The second greatest value Old Orchard Beach apartment is the Colindale Model at Colindale Estates starting at $1,700 with a $1.79 price per square foot . Here is today’s list of the best values for Old Orchard Beach apartments based on price per square foot:
Apartment Listing | Model Name | Bed/Bath | Price Per Sq.Ft. |
---|---|---|---|
104 Ocean Ave, Unit D | 104 Ocean Ave | 3BR,1BA | $2.08 |
Colindale Estates | Colindale | 2BR,1BA | $1.79 |
Cloverleaf Apartments | One Bedroom | 1BR,1BA | $3.25 |
